2 Seritone Matching System Shades Simulated From Seritone Base Colors This booklet furnishes the necessary formulas to simulate all the "C" colors of the Color Guide, except Double print, Fluorescent, and Metallic Colors. Each formula was printed through a TW (153/cm) monofilament screen with a 75 durometer sharp edge squeegee, without thinning, on Leneta Opacity Cards. All formulas are presented by weight. However, due to variations in ink film thickness, screen mesh, and other variables, some formulas may need adjustments. The Seritone Matching System (SMS) has been designed to enable screen printers to simulate almost any shade from nine SMS Base Colors plus Shading Black, Tinting White, and Mixing Clear. Each SMS Base Color has been carefully selected for its cleanliness of tone, resistance to fading, and suitability for intermixing. In addition, each ink has been formulated to be free of lead and other heavy metals. Although every care is taken in producing these formulations, variations in substrates and printing conditions will affect color achieved. Fujifilm Sericol USA Inc. assumes no responsibility for actual color achieved. For this reason, all formulations must be proofed, prior to production run, to ensure color accuracy. In some cases, to accurately simulate a shade, considerable amounts of Mixing Clear and/or Tinting White are in the formulation. The exterior durability of color mixes with high percentages of Mixing Clear and/or Tinting White will be reduced. The Technical Services Department, in many cases, can provide an alternate simulation formula yielding improved exterior durability. The SMS Base Colors are listed below and are available in single gallon containers: DESCRIPTION FC-064 SMS Yellow GS (Green Shade) FC-066 SMS Yellow RS (Red Shade) FC-114 SMS Orange FC-121 SMS Red YS (Yellow Shade) FC-127 SMS Violet FC-164 SMS Red BS (Blue Shade) FC-165 SMS Magenta FC-230 SMS Blue FC-325 SMS Green FC-TW SMS Tinting White FC-SB SMS Shading Black FC-MX SMS Mixing Clear Fujifilm Sericol USA Inc's color mixing ink formulations for screen process printing produce only simulations of Colors in this color reproduction method due to differences in ink film, opacity and pigment selection.
